B.Tech Electrical Engineering syllabus is structured to get theoretical and practical exposure in circuit design, control systems, signal processing, conditioning, etc. The students are introduced to all the significant engineering streams and engineering fundamentals as foundation subjects in the first year. B.Tech Electrical Engineering subjects include basic English and other quantitative and reasoning modules to enhance students' communication and aptitude skills. 

Semester Wise B.Tech Electrical Engineering Syllabus

The main subjects of B.Tech Electrical Engineering include control systems, power electronics, sensor and measurement devices, signal processing, and much more. The curriculum is divided into four parts that incorporate the foundational courses in the initial semesters, core-based subjects combined with laboratories, and industrial projects in the following semesters.

The course structure for B.Tech Electrical Engineering isn't concrete and heavily varies from one university to another. AICTE recommends the course structures followed by private universities. The list below consists of a semester-wise split-up of the syllabus.

B.Tech Electrical Engineering Subjects

B.Tech Electrical Engineering subjects are classified as fundamentals, core, elective, and lab subjects. Lab practicals and workshops are an essential part of the B.Tech Electrical Engineering course. Students can choose elective subjects based on their interests, career scopes, or future education goals. 

Core Subjects:

  • Power Systems
  • Microcontrollers and Microprocessors
  • Control Systems
  • Instrumentation
  • Signals and Systems
  • Electric Drives
  • Materials in Electrical Systems
  • Power Electronics
  • Circuit Designing

B.Tech Electrical Engineering Course Structure

In general, a B.Tech Electrical Engineering course is structured as a combination of core and elective subjects. The time is divided into eight semesters comprising fundamental engineering subjects in the first year. The course provides more focus on engineering, physics and mathematics. Aspirants will be introduced to electrical core subjects and choose electives based on their specialization and areas of interest and need to submit research-based practical projects at the end of the VIII semester. The course structure is:

  • VIII Semesters
  • Fundamental, Core and Elective subjects
  • Mandatory Internship
  • Project Submission
  • Research Journal Publication

B.Tech Electrical Engineering Teaching Methodology and Techniques

B.Tech Electrical Engineering encompasses different teaching methods that are required. Apart from the basic traditional lecture-based training, the students are also provided industrial ready training with electrical engineering labs, group projects, and other action-based learning methods. Students can either work as a team or work as individuals for the final year project that provides practical solutions to modern-day industrial challenges. The research project motivates the candidates for more in-depth research, understanding others’ perceptions, brainstorming, and providing adequate practical engineering knowledge. In short, the teaching methodology and techniques are:

  • Practical Sessions
  • Group Projects
  • Case Methodology 
  • Workshop
  • Industrial Visits
  • Industrial Internship

B.Tech Electrical Engineering Projects

Students can take up B.Tech Electrical Engineering projects on automotive designing, electronics, automation and manufacturing, and pure electrical. The project motivates the students to enhance their application skills in designing, developing, research-based analysis, circuit analysis, mechanics, and electrical devices. The students are trained to work with any product from start to finish, including circuit designing, research, and checking functionality.

Popular Electrical Engineering projects are:

  • GSM based accident control and monitoring
  • IoT based Robotics Project
  • Electric Bike
  • Photovoltaic Solar power generation 
  • Agricultural Robots
  • PIN Diode based sensor 

B.Tech Electrical Engineering Reference Books

Listed below are the reference books used for B.Tech Electrical Engineering.

B.Tech Electrical Engineering Reference Books
Books Authors
A Book of Electrical Technology B.L.Theraja
Automatic Control Systems Benjamin Kuo
First Course on Power Electronics and Drives Ned Mohan
Modern Power System Analysis D.P. Kothari and I.J. Nagrath
Modern Digital Electronics R P Jain
Fundamentals of Energy Production Harder Edwin
Control System Engineering I.J. Nagrath and Gopal
